服务器如何配置环境设置,深入解析服务器环境配置,全面指南与实战技巧
- 综合资讯
- 2024-10-30 09:01:48
- 2

深入解析服务器环境配置,本文提供全面指南与实战技巧,涵盖服务器环境设置的方法与步骤,帮助读者掌握高效配置服务器环境的技巧。...
深入解析服务器环境配置,本文提供全面指南与实战技巧,涵盖服务器环境设置的方法与步骤,帮助读者掌握高效配置服务器环境的技巧。
随着互联网技术的飞速发展,服务器已成为企业、个人用户不可或缺的重要基础设施,在服务器部署过程中,环境配置是至关重要的环节,本文将深入解析服务器环境配置,涵盖操作系统、数据库、中间件等多个方面,旨在帮助读者全面了解服务器环境配置,提高服务器运维能力。
操作系统配置
1、选择合适的操作系统
服务器操作系统种类繁多,如Windows Server、Linux、Unix等,选择合适的操作系统需考虑以下因素:
(1)应用需求:根据业务需求选择支持所需应用的操作系统中。
(2)安全性:考虑操作系统的安全性,如Linux系统的安全性较高。
(3)稳定性:选择稳定性较高的操作系统,降低服务器故障率。
2、系统优化
(1)关闭不必要的服务:删除或禁用不需要的系统服务,提高系统性能。
(2)调整系统参数:优化系统参数,如TCP/IP参数、文件系统参数等。
(3)磁盘分区:合理分区磁盘,提高数据读写效率。
3、软件安装
(1)安装必要的软件:根据业务需求安装所需软件。
(2)软件版本选择:选择稳定性高、性能优良的软件版本。
(3)软件兼容性:确保软件之间兼容,避免出现冲突。
数据库配置
1、选择合适的数据库
根据业务需求选择合适的数据库,如MySQL、Oracle、SQL Server等。
2、数据库优化
(1)配置参数:优化数据库参数,如连接数、缓存大小等。
(2)索引优化:合理设计索引,提高查询效率。
(3)存储优化:选择合适的存储引擎,如InnoDB、MyISAM等。
3、数据备份与恢复
(1)定期备份:制定合理的备份策略,定期备份数据。
(2)备份验证:验证备份数据的有效性。
(3)恢复操作:在数据丢失或损坏时,能够快速恢复数据。
中间件配置
1、Web服务器配置
(1)选择合适的Web服务器:如Apache、Nginx等。
(2)优化配置:调整Web服务器参数,提高性能。
(3)安全配置:设置防火墙、SSL证书等,保障服务器安全。
2、应用服务器配置
(1)选择合适的应用服务器:如Tomcat、Jboss等。
(2)优化配置:调整应用服务器参数,提高性能。
(3)安全配置:设置防火墙、SSL证书等,保障服务器安全。
3、消息队列配置
(1)选择合适的消息队列:如RabbitMQ、Kafka等。
(2)配置参数:优化消息队列参数,提高性能。
(3)集群部署:实现消息队列的高可用和负载均衡。
网络安全配置
1、防火墙配置
(1)设置规则:合理设置防火墙规则,允许必要的流量,拒绝非法访问。
(2)监控日志:定期查看防火墙日志,发现异常流量。
2、安全防护
(1)杀毒软件:安装杀毒软件,防止病毒入侵。
(2)入侵检测:部署入侵检测系统,及时发现并阻止攻击。
(3)数据加密:对敏感数据进行加密,防止数据泄露。
服务器环境配置是服务器运维过程中的重要环节,本文从操作系统、数据库、中间件、网络安全等多个方面,全面解析了服务器环境配置,掌握这些配置技巧,有助于提高服务器性能、稳定性和安全性,在实际工作中,还需根据具体业务需求进行调整和优化。
本文链接:https://www.zhitaoyun.cn/435354.html
发表评论